I bought a 2016 Viking bunkhouse off of a dealership in my local community. This had been previously purchased and only owned for about two weeks before the driver returned it because pulling a trailer scared them. So I bought it on consignment with absolutely nothing wrong with it. It was brand new. Not even seven years later and all of the factory welds have started to fail so I reached out to my local insurance adjuster and they said sorry that is a manufacturers defect from when the steel was poured into the frame. So then I reached out to this company asking if they could help in anyway as it seems pretty ridiculous that within seven years, all the welds would start failing. I sent them photos. I sent them a welders report And all sorts of stuff. In the beginning, they seem like they were going to help me out. But in the end they didn’t. They just pretty much said oh well sucks to be you and that’s it. No further communication. So I would never buy from this company or especially this model or namebrand or anything from this company as they don’t honour their work. I am a military family with two little girls and our entire summer is now blown because of the faulty workmanship that was sold to me. I can’t give a negative star, or I would. I highly recommend you take your money somewhere else because the quality sold by this company is garbage.

2016 Sierra 393RL Destination Trailer-A beautiful unit, lot of window, spacious layout, perfect destination home. Unfortunately the rest of the story is not so nice. We opened our unit in May and immediately noticed the dreaded mold smell. Seems like it was coming from the corner of the front slide. Water runs down the slide onto the exterior edge of the floor which is covered with a plastic which has holes due to UV exposure and traps water inside, poor design. While lifting the carpet in the front section under the couch, her foot stepped through the floor, both sides next to the slides are severely rotted. The water is trapped between the flooring where it can sit forever. This is not visible from the interior or exterior unless you were to take the unit apart. Bad design, will be an extremely expensive repair. Would not purchase a Forest River ever again.

I purchased the 2016 Forest River Sandpiper 393RL in May of 2016. It is known as a destination rv because people who buy them generally take them from the lot to a recreation lot and park them for long term. It is my home away from home. I live in it from June to September every year. It has everything I need (except a dishwasher). Large 25cf refridgerator with bottom freezer (electric only), 40+" bigscreen, electric fireplace, surround sound, 2 recliners, queen size hide-a-bed for guests. Dinette table with 4 chairs. Island kitchen. Loads of storage space. Soft close drawers. It is totally comfortable with just under 400 sq ft. A good size bathroom with 42" shower. A large bedroom. Room for washer and dryer. Have had no problems with anything in or on it in 6 years. Black tank gets dumped every 3 weeks. Hooked to city water and hook up for septic. Never used my extended warrantee pkg. It's been the perfect summer home for me and would work year round if needed. Cant rate driving/towing or Factory/ dealer support because I haven't had a need to use them. At the end if summer, empty tanks and pull in the 3 slides. Its waiting and ready for another season.
